Kinds Of Cheap Fireplaces
When browsing for a cost effective fireplace, a number of types are offered that deal with various spending plans and home styles. Below is a list of some typical categories of low-cost fireplaces:
1. Electric FireplacesOverview: These fireplaces use electrical energy to create heat and replicate the appearance of genuine flames.Pros: No emissions, simple installation, and adjustable heat settings.Cons: Higher electric costs, not appropriate for all visual appeals.2. Gas FireplacesSummary: Rely on natural gas or lp to produce real flames.Pros: Efficient heat output, instantaneous heat, and often featured push-button controls.Cons: Requires gas line setup, which might incur extra costs.3. Wood-Burning StovesOverview: These traditional fireplaces burn wood logs to produce heat and ambiance.Pros: Lower running costs if wood is sourced in your area, genuine experience.Cons: Requires more upkeep, a chimney system, and sourcing fire wood.4. Bioethanol FireplacesIntroduction: Use bioethanol to produce real flames without being linked to a flue.Pros: Portable, simple to establish, and produces little smoke.Cons: Limited heat output and can be pricey if utilized often.5. When selecting a cheap fireplace, several factors ought to be considered to guarantee that the purchase lines up with your home's requirements and budget:

Space and Size
Assess the size of the room where the fireplace will be installed. Bigger spaces may need more powerful heating options, whereas smaller spaces may benefit from compact electric or bioethanol designs.
Fuel Type
Choose between electric, gas, wood, or bioethanol based upon accessibility, individual preference, and regional policies relating to emissions and security.
Setup Requirements
Think about whether the fireplace needs comprehensive setup work, such as venting and chimney construction, which can substantially increase expenses.
Expense of Operation
Compute the ongoing fuel or electrical power costs to preserve heat throughout the cold weather.
Visual Design

When a cheap fireplace is installed, proper upkeep is vital for safety and longevity. Here are some important maintenance tips:
Schedule Annual Inspections: For gas and wood-burning fireplaces, it's necessary to have a yearly evaluation to look for gas leaks or blockages in the chimney.Regular Cleaning: Dust and keep electric fireplaces and clear out ash from wood-burning ranges to prevent fire threats.Correct Fuel Storage: For wood-burning ranges, shop fire wood in a dry location to ensure effective burning and prevent mold growth.Usage Quality Fuel: Always utilize ideal fuel for gas and bioethanol fireplaces to prevent excess soot and emissions.Set Up Carbon Monoxide Detectors: For gas or wood-burning designs, set up detectors to ensure that any leakage of damaging gases is rapidly identified.FAQs1. What is the most inexpensive type of fireplace?
Electric fireplaces are normally among the most budget friendly choices, offering a series of rates that can fit most spending plans.
2. Can I install a fireplace myself to conserve cash?
While some electric and bioethanol fireplaces can be quickly set up without professional help, gas and wood-burning models usually need installation by a licensed specialist to ensure security.
3. How long do electric fireplaces last?
Electric fireplaces can last for many years with correct care, usually around 10-15 years, depending on use and the quality of the unit.
4. What is the most effective fireplace?
Gas fireplaces tend to be the most effective, offering instantaneous heat with controlled emissions.
5. How do I understand if my fireplace is safe to use?
Regular inspections, correct cleaning, and ensuring that there are no obstructions or leaks can help preserve security in any type of fireplace.
